We report the first experimental demonstration of using wavelength-div
ision-multiplexing and wavelength-selective-detection to facilitate ei
ther reconfigurable or simultaneous optical interconnections between o
ne source plane and many detector planes, We show the 10(-9) BER, 155
Mb/s transmission and detection of three different wavelength-multiple
xed signals at three detector planes. The reconfigurable interconnecti
on is established with a wavelength separation of 10 nm, and the simul
taneous interconnection is established with a wavelength separation of
43 nm.
